A WOMAN was hit by a train yesterday between Paisley Gilmour Street and Johnstone.

British Transport Police were called to Gilmour Street station at around 4.20pm after a woman in her 50s was struck on the line.

She was uninjured but was taken to hospital to be assessed.

A British Transport Police spokesman said: "We were called to Paisley Gilmour Street station at 4.22pm yesterday and a woman was taken to hospital after being hit by a train.

"We believe she is still in hospital at the moment.

"She was not injured."

Services between Glasgow Central and Ardrossan Harbour, Ayr and Largs were disrupted last night following the incident.
